Learning a language requires a certain attitude of openness towards the new language and the way it sounds. You may try to learn French, for example, but then not want to let go of the way your own language sounds. What can make the process harder than it has to be is when people want to force the new language to behave like their old one. Each language has its own rules. The way words and phrases are put together differs from language to another. Often, people new to learning languages will expect everything to operate in the way they are familiar with. To learn French means that you have to be open to all its rules and grammar and not only the way individual words are spoken.

Flashcards can be very useful. Flashcards sometimes have a bad name since they're used a lot to teach kids, however in regards to learning a new foreign language this method trumps virtually everything else. After all, why should I use flash cards with all the cutting-edge technology that's available? The short and honest answer is because they work! Remember in your school days, how helpful flash cards were in helping you study for your exams? Nothing else on the market is as convenient as flashcards; take them to any place and use them at any time. Also, flashcards prove useful when practicing with an associate that has no experience in your new language, all they have to do is tell you if your answer is wrong or right. When push comes to shove, flash cards have passed the test of time as one of the easiest tools around for a new language learner.

Try to read books and magazines that are written in French. If you want to get more comfortable with how to create sentences, as well as improve your vocabulary, reading in French is great practice. If you want to become accustomed to the specific ways words are used and the rules of grammar work, the best method is to practice reading in that language. The more you read in French (or whatever language you're trying to learn) the more you will be able to understand the language when it is spoken and the easier it will be for you to communicate in that language when you want to use it to speak or write to others.

French Audio Lessons

When setting out to learn a second language such as French, it is important to have the time, the right attitude, and the right tools. Fortunately, there are many great language tools available for the language student today.

There are many great books, flash card sets and websites that do a brilliant job teaching the written French language. However, an essential key to success is to add audio lessons to your study routine. Including audio is crucial for a number of reasons.

When a person focuses all of their efforts on the written word, it is certainly possible to learn a lot of stuff, but it's also likely that they might be learning the wrong things. What is meant by this is that a student could have a sense of how a word sounds that, since they have never actually heard it spoken, could be completely wrong. They continue to study and learn, reinforcing the incorrect pronunciation in their head. Eventually they'll use it, be corrected, and then have to relearn the word or words all over again.

Audio French Lessons Sandy

The brain learns better when it's challenged in lots of different ways. By combining reading and writing French with hearing it as well, the brain will retain the information much better than just reading it. Adding audio also helps maintain the student's interest, as studying doesn't get boring when it involves different inputs.

Another very positive aspect of audio French lessons is convenience. The ability to listen to French in the car, working out, or anywhere else is a huge plus. The more often that you hear it, the better you will learn and retain it.

Audio lessons with native French speakers can teach so much that cannot be learned from a book. The proper pronunciation as well as conversational tone and inflection can only be learned by listening. By repeatedly listening to French, one can develop their own, natural sounding conversational tone instead of a strained, mechanical, "by the book" style that is very unnatural.

Some computer programs offer the option of being able to record yourself speaking French, too. Being able to hear it, speak it, then replay and compare the two is very helpful. Having this instant feedback and being able to make adjustments is a great learning tool.

Read it, write it, and listen to it. This multimedia approach will enhance your French language learning much more quickly and make it much more interesting, too.
